AppDelegate瘦身
来源:互联网 发布:天庭淘宝店851 编辑:程序博客网 时间:2024/04/28 02:41
由于项目需求的增多,项目中需要启动时进行加载的东西越来越多,AppDelegate变得越来越大,显得很臃肿,于是就对AppDelegate进行了简化,具体做法如下:
1.首先创建一个继承于AppDelegate的类文件YDStartAppDelegate
2.把需要启动的部分代码写在YDStartAppDelegate中
3.最后在AppDelegate中导入头文件即可,因为当类对象被引入到项目中时,runtime会向每一个类对象发送一个load消息,load方法会在每一个类甚至分类被引入时仅调用一次,调用的顺序是父类优先于子类,并且load方法不会被类自动集成,每一个类的load方法都不需要像viewDidLoad 方法一样调用父类.
1 0
- AppDelegate瘦身
- AppDelegate瘦身
- Notification Once为AppDelegate瘦身
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- AppDelegate
- appdelegate
- AppDelegate
- AppDelegate
- AppDelegate
- pthread_once实现简析
- USACO-Fractions to Decimals
- socket connec连接超时处理
- 人情感悟
- iOS - Icon图标、启动图片、审核图片尺寸
- AppDelegate瘦身
- exit在codeblocks编译环境下在哪个头文件中声明
- 3、RedHat6 集群ISCSI
- Java NIO和IO之间的主要差别
- ios Pod安装使用 + Podfile 文件格式示范
- Service使用全解析
- Qt Drag and Drop
- 对象的3种初始化方式
- IPA提交APPStore问题记录(一)